Affordable E-commerce SEO: Strategies for Small Businesses to Thrive Online
In the digital age, having an online existence is not just a choice but a need, especially for e-commerce businesses. Nevertheless, standing out in a congested market can be tough, especially for small businesses with restricted resources. Effective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is crucial for increasing visibility, driving traffic, and ultimately enhancing sales. This post explores affordable SEO strategies that small e-commerce businesses can carry out to grow online.
Understanding the Importance of SEO
SEO is the procedure of optimizing a website to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s). Higher rankings indicate more visibility, which translates into more organic traffic and, ultimately, more sales. For e-commerce businesses, SEO is particularly crucial because it assists prospective clients discover and acquire products online.
Affordable SEO Strategies for E-commerce
Keyword Research
- Why It Matters: Keywords are the foundation of SEO. They help online search engine comprehend what your website is about and match it with relevant search inquiries.
- How to Do It: Use totally free tools like Google Keyword Planner, Ubersuggest, or Answer the general public to determine pertinent keywords. Focus on long-tail keywords, which are more specific and have less competition.
- Action Steps:
- Create a list of main and secondary keywords.
- Incorporate these keywords naturally into your product titles, descriptions, and meta tags.
Optimize Product Pages
- Why It Matters: Each product page is a potential entry point for customers. Optimizing these pages can significantly enhance your SEO.
- How to Do It: Ensure each item page has a distinct title, meta description, and header tags. Usage premium images and alt text to improve availability and searchability.
- Action Steps:
- Use descriptive and keyword-rich titles and meta descriptions.
- Include pertinent keywords in the H1 and H2 tags.
- Optimize images with alt text and compress them for faster filling times.
Enhance Website Speed
- Why It Matters: Page load speed is a critical element in SEO. Faster sites offer a much better user experience and are most likely to rank greater in search outcomes.
- How to Do It: Use tools like Google PageSpeed Insights to determine and repair issues that slow down your website. Enhance images, minify CSS and JavaScript, and utilize a content delivery network (CDN) if possible.
- Action Steps:
- Compress images to minimize file size.
- Minify CSS and JavaScript files.
- Use a CDN to serve content quicker.
Construct Quality Backlinks
- Why It Matters: Backlinks are links from other sites to your website. They signify to search engines that your content is important and reliable.
- How to Do It: Focus on building high-quality, relevant backlinks. Guest blogging, collaborations, and social networks can be efficient methods to earn backlinks.
- Action Steps:
- Reach out to market blog sites and provide to write guest posts.
- Work together with other businesses for co-marketing chances.
- Share your content on social networks to increase presence.
Leverage Social Media
- Why It Matters: Social media platforms can drive traffic to your website and improve your online existence. They also help develop brand awareness and consumer commitment.
- How to Do It: Create and share valuable content that resonates with your target audience. Engage with your followers and take part in appropriate conversations.
- Action Steps:
- Post frequently on plat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ter.
- Use hashtags to increase exposure.
- Encourage user-generated content and evaluations.
Optimize for Mobile
- Why It Matters: Mobile devices represent a substantial part of online traffic. A mobile-friendly website is essential for a great user experience and SEO.
- How to Do It: Use a responsive design that adjusts to different screen sizes. Check your website on different devices to guarantee it looks and works well.
- Action Steps:
- Use a responsive style or template.
- Check your website on numerous gadgets.
- Ensure your content is simple to read and navigate on mobile.
Use Local SEO
- Why It Matters: If your e-commerce business has a physical place or serves a particular geographic area, local SEO can help you reach neighboring customers.
- How to Do It: Claim and optimize your Google My Business listing. Include your address, contact number, and business hours. Motivate clients to leave evaluations.
- Action Steps:
- Claim your Google My Business listing.
- Use local keywords in your content.
- Encourage satisfied clients to leave positive evaluations.
FAQs
Q: How long does it take to see arise from SEO?A: SEO is a long-lasting strategy, and results can differ. Usually, it can take several months to see considerable improvements in rankings and traffic. Consistency is essential.
Q: Can I do SEO on my own, or do I require to work with an expert?A: While it's possible to do SEO on your own, it needs time, effort, and a great understanding of best practices. If you have actually limited time or resources, think about hiring a professional or utilizing affordable SEO tools.
Q: How often should I update my website content?A: Regular updates are crucial to keep your website fresh and pertinent. Objective to upgrade your content at least as soon as a month, but more regularly if possible.
Q: What are some complimentary tools I can utilize for SEO?A: Some popular free tools include Google Keyword Planner, Google Analytics, Google Search Console, and Ubersuggest. These tools can assist you with keyword research, site audits, and performance tracking.
Q: Is it required to have a blog for my e-commerce website?A: While not necessary, a blog can be a valuable addition to your e-commerce site. It offers a chance to create valuable content, attract backlinks, and improve your SEO.
